Summary
Texas Instruments Inc. (TXN) filed a Current Report (8-K) on April 22, 2026, primarily announcing its first-quarter results of operations and financial condition. The report incorporates a news release detailing these results, which investors should review for specific financial performance metrics. Notably, the filing emphasizes the use of non-GAAP financial measures, such as free cash flow and related ratios. Texas Instruments asserts that these non-GAAP figures offer valuable insights into the company's liquidity, its ability to generate cash, and the potential for returning capital to shareholders, complementing the standard GAAP reporting.
